About the Organization:
Vision Fund Micro Finance Institution (S.C) is an Institution established according to proclamation No. 40/96 to provide financial services to the productive poor in the rural and urban areas of Ethiopia. Vision Fund is currently operating in five of the Regional States of the country.

The Credit Analyst is responsible for data collection, assessment of performance of Area and Branch Offices and prepares performance reports; follows up low performing Branches and gives feedback the supervisors. He/she also coordinates operational activities related to loan disbursement and repayment of the Company.
§ Supports and advice Branch Office staff in all areas of the core process data capturing tasks and other activities that need support of the Department;
§ Supports and guides the Branch Offices for proper data capturing procedure and reports any deviation of report from the intended one to the Area Manager
§ Collects monthly and timely status report from the Branch Offices and responsible to produce performance reports coordinating the data capturing team in a way suitable for users;
§ Reviews the performances of each branch against the annual target, communicates the Branch offices for any clarification of variances on performance against the plan and submits written status and progress report to the supervisors;
§ Responsible to follow the performances of low performing branches as well as loan programs.
§ Strictly follows and reports the status of past due and delinquent loans to the Supervisors and follows the implementation of the actions to be taken to recover the loan;
§ Ensures the accuracy of performance reports and checks the accuracy of the report with the Area financial reports and reconciles the two reports whenever there is a difference;
§ Regularly follows collection plan and performances and insuring timely utilization of funds;
§ Communicates and provides input to the supervisors in making decision about the transfer of idle fund to branches;
§ Facilitates the fulfillment of operational formats of the branches and request for printing based on the required volume of the branches in the Area;
§ Identifies possible credit risks through analysis of clients business, field supervision, referring loan repayments and predictions from informal reports; closely follows up the performance of credit: Disbursement progress; repayment progress of fresh loan; repayment progress of loan in arrears;
§ Identifies threats and opportunities of credit operation in the fiscal year under probe and reports to the Supervisors;
§ Reviews the reports of branches periodically to identify the irregularities that might occur and forwards the scrutinized challenges with the most likely solutions to the supervisors;
§ Maintains an adequate database on credit and all other relevant information;
§ Reports any problem, which cannot be solved at his/her capacity to his /her immediate Supervisors for remedial action;
§ Carries out performance analysis using various tools;
§ Takes part on the study of new branch offices to be opened in the fiscal year;
§ Prepares the yearly operational formats requirements timely;
§ Produces timely reports on credit operation on daily, weekly, monthly and quarterly basis;
§ Performs other duties as may be given by the Supervisor.
